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68 6536 50485
8928 9895 01436552002
8928 9895 01436552002
73876517 4403254279 8049045
All about undefined
Interested in learning more?
8928 9895 01436552002
73876517 4403254279 8049045
See more
1641 5755242096
982843667 39989 56272
See more
1642 2809 36286
33 84954328 14068261
See more